What is Zoho Creator?
Zoho Creator is an online service to create and manage online database applications. It relieves you from the pain of learning programming languages to build web applications for your custom needs.
From what our customer said:
Zoho Creator = MS Access + VB on the web
What can I do with Zoho Creator?

For example, convert you Expenses.xls to an online database. Now, you and your family members can enter their expenses using the expense form, online. In the end of the month, you can get total expenses and generate reports.
For example,
personal tracking applications like Calorie tracker, Library manager (or)
work related applications for a specific need. If you are an HR folk and want to organize a seasonal gift. You can create "Fill-in your T-Shirt size" application in minutes and share it with you colleagues.